Resumo: | The objective was to evaluate the genetic value of two populations of quails according to the coefficient of inbreeding and generations. Two pedigrees of quails of the species Coturnix coturnix coturnix were analyzed: EV1 and EV2 bred under conditions of random mating and under selection pressure for characteristic body weight. The inbreeding coefficients and the genetic value of the animals were calculated according to the methodology described in the WOMBAT program (Meyer, 2007); for birth weight weighing, seven, 14, 21, 28 and 35 days of age. Estimates of inbreeding depression were obtained through records with a non-zero inbreeding coefficient and the respective genetic value were submitted to regression analysis by the SAS Studio software, through PROC REG including the effect of generations on the analyzes. When a quadratic or linear effect was found for the inbreeding coefficient and a linear effect for generations, the genetic values were organized in a response surface graph. A curvilinear effect was observed for the inbreeding coefficient in both populations. |
